Effects of the March 1989 solar activity

Description

Two weeks of intense solar activity which produced an historically great magnetic storm occurred in March 1989. Here, the observed effects of that activity are described, including the injection of energetic particles to geostationary orbit, the extreme magnetospheric compression, the cosmic ray penetration, radiation belt precipitation, geomagnetic storms and substorms, and extremely large auroral zone, and radio aurorae that resulted from the activity are reviewed. The effects of the activity on technological systems on earth and in space are addressed
